How Low to Hang Pendant Lights: The Ultimate Guide

The Pendant Light Dilemma: Getting the Height Right

Pendant lights are a fantastic way to add style and focused light to any space. But the big question is always: how do you get the height just right? Hanging them too high means they lose their impact and don't provide adequate illumination. Too low, and they become obstacles, visually cluttering the room and potentially causing a hazard. Finding that sweet spot is key to a successful lighting design. This guide provides a straightforward approach to determining the ideal pendant light height for various rooms and situations.

The challenge many homeowners face is understanding that there's no single "magic number." The optimal height depends on several factors, including the room's purpose, ceiling height, and the size and style of the pendant itself. This guide will help you navigate these variables with confidence.

Key Considerations for Pendant Light Height

Before you even think about grabbing a measuring tape, consider these crucial factors:

  • Ceiling Height: This is your baseline. Higher ceilings allow for more flexibility, while lower ceilings demand careful consideration to avoid a cramped feel.
  • Room Function: A pendant over a kitchen island has different requirements than one in a living room or hallway. Functionality dictates placement.
  • Pendant Size and Style: A large, dramatic pendant needs more breathing room than a small, minimalist one. The design also influences how the light is distributed.
  • Personal Preference: Ultimately, you want something that looks and feels right to you. Don’t be afraid to adjust based on your own aesthetic sensibilities.

Specific Room Guidelines

Let’s break down the recommended heights for different areas of your home:

  • Kitchen Island: For kitchen islands, a general rule of thumb is to hang pendant lights 28-36 inches above the countertop. This ensures ample task lighting without obstructing views or bumping heads. Consider how low to hang pendant lights over a kitchen island if you have taller bar stools.

  • Dining Table: Over a dining table, aim for 28-36 inches above the table surface. This provides direct light for dining and creates an inviting atmosphere.

  • Living Room: In a living room, the height can vary more depending on the pendant's purpose. If it's accent lighting, higher placement may work. If it's intended for reading or conversation, lower placement is better. A good starting point is 7 feet from the floor.

  • Hallways and Entryways: Ensure pendants are at least 7 feet above the floor to prevent anyone from hitting their head.

Addressing Common Scenarios

Now, let’s tackle some specific situations you might encounter:

  • High Ceilings: With high ceilings, you have more leeway. You can hang pendants lower to create a more intimate feel. Consider using longer chains or rods to achieve the desired height. The question for high ceilings is, how low should a pendant light hang with high ceilings to still feel proportional?

  • Sloped or Vaulted Ceilings: These require a bit more creativity. Use adjustable pendants or those with swiveling canopies to ensure they hang straight. The goal is to position the pendant so it's level and provides even light distribution.

  • Adjustable Pendants: These are incredibly versatile, allowing you to fine-tune the height as needed. They're especially useful in areas where the function might change, like a multi-purpose room.

Style and Finish Considerations

Beyond height, the style and finish of your pendant lights play a significant role in the overall look and feel of your space.

  • Modern Pendants: Often feature sleek lines and minimalist designs. Popular materials include metal, glass, and acrylic.

  • Farmhouse Pendants: Embrace rustic charm with materials like wood, metal, and mason jars.

  • Glass Pendants: Offer a timeless elegance and can be clear, frosted, or colored. The transparency of the glass affects the light diffusion.

  • Brass, Black, and Chrome Finishes: These are all popular choices, each offering a distinct aesthetic. Brass adds warmth, black provides a modern edge, and chrome offers a classic, polished look.

  • Small and Mini Pendants: Ideal for smaller spaces or for creating clusters of light.

  • Linear Pendants: Perfect for illuminating long surfaces like kitchen islands or dining tables.

  • Cluster Pendants: Create a dramatic focal point with multiple lights grouped together.

When choosing a finish, consider the other fixtures and hardware in the room to create a cohesive design.
